Fair Oaks Battlefield

Fair Oaks, Virginia. Frame house on Fair Oaks battlefield used by Hooker's Division as a hospital

 

You are looking at an artistic picture of Fair Oaks, Virginia. Frame house on Fair Oaks battlefield used by Hooker's Division as a hospital. It was created in 1862 by Gibson, James F., b. 1828.

The picture presents United States.
